Schumann resorts awarded "Best Place to session a precision terrain park" in the 2009 SBC Ski and Snowboard Resort Guide!


SBC Ski and Snowboard Resort Guide on news stands today awarded Schumann Resorts "Best place to session a precision terrain park - Big White and Silver Star".


In a collaborative effort between seasoned park masterminds, dedicated grooming staff and a long lasting sponsorship commitment from TELUS  means parks with safe, precision features all winter long, said SBC resort guide. No wonder they've helped produce such talent as TJ Schiller, Mark Sollars, Geoff Pepperdine, Jess Kimura and Josh Bibby.The SBC resort guides tip is "definitely spend some time in the ultra refined TELUS terrain parks at both Big White and Silver Star. TELUS and both resorts have invested millions of dollars in the design and upkeep of world class parks with immaculate features".Also, adds Jess Kimura "Get more bang for your buck with the dual mountain passes that are the same price but valid at both resorts. What you see is what you get, theres is no stuck up luxury resort attitudes here, the true defintition of ski-in, ski-out. You can literally jump off your balcony onto the runs. It also adds some urban jib flavour to the cat tracks, with plenty of rails jibs, wall rides and ledges" continued Kimura. 

"I was very pleased to walk in to the Toronto Ski and Snowboard show today, Canada's biggest ski and snowboard consumer event and be handed the award contained in the new SBC Resort Guide Magazine", commented Schumann Resorts Senior Vice President Michael J Ballingall. 

"I am especially pleased that they recognized the extreme efforts of  our dedicated staff to produce our world class terrain parks. I am sure we'll celebrate when we all get back to the Okanagan as many of our team members are spread throughout North America and Europe at various consumer shows at this time of year".
